Born in Vranje in 1953. Finished elementary school in Varazdin and high school in Belgrade . Graduated from Belgrade Faculty of Science and Mathematics, course Mathematics, in 1976. Got the MSc degree in 1980, and the PhD degree in 1990.
Previous positions: secondary school "Jezdimir Lovric", teacher of Mathematics (1976-1980); Serbian Institute of Statistics, electronic data processing designer, (1980-1995); Automobile Association of Yugoslavia, computer centre manager (1985-1994); Belgrade Faculty of Economics, Assistant Professor (1994-1999), Associate Professor (1999-).
Professional improvement and advanced training: Düsseldorf, sponsored by the OECD (1984); Paris, London , Brussels , Frankfurt , Bonn , Rome , sponsored by the EEC (1989).

Used to teach informatics-related subjects at the Faculties of Economics in Brcko and Prilep, Tourist College in Belgrade , Business College in Belgrade and Foreign Trade College in Bijeljina.
Other professional activities: Member of the Scientific Society of Yugoslav Economists, Serbian Statistical Society and Tourist Forum of Yugoslavia. In the period 1985 – 1990, he was a member of project teams for introduction of international information systems for electronic data exchange and took an active part in their conferences in the Hague, Munich, Paris, Rome and Copenhagen. Used to be the Head or a member of expert teams for designing over 40 information systems in the country and abroad ( New York , Zurich , Berlin ).
